Biomarkers in inflammometry pediatric asthma: utility in daily clinical practice

Insights

Accurate childhood asthma diagnosis is crucial. Combining serum total IgE, blood eosinophilia, and fractional exhaled nitric oxide (FeNO) levels improves diagnosis, phenotyping, and management for better adult asthma outcomes.

Background:

  • Asthma is a prevalent chronic respiratory disease affecting children globally.
  • Early and accurate diagnosis, treatment, and follow-up in childhood are vital for managing adult asthma and preventing undertreatment or overtreatment.

Purpose of the Study:

  • To evaluate the utility of Th2 inflammatory markers in diagnosing and managing childhood asthma.
  • To assess the combined diagnostic and prognostic value of serum total IgE, blood eosinophilia, and fractional exhaled nitric oxide (FeNO) levels.

Main Methods:

  • Assessment of Th2 inflammation using serum total IgE and blood eosinophilia.
  • Measurement of fractional exhaled nitric oxide (FeNO) levels.
  • Evaluation of marker combinations for diagnostic accuracy and treatment monitoring in pediatric asthma patients.

Main Results:

  • Serum total IgE, blood eosinophilia, and FeNO levels can predict asthma, especially in young children unable to perform lung function tests.
  • FeNO measurements can help monitor treatment adherence.
  • An isolated marker measurement is insufficient; combining these markers enhances diagnostic capability.

Conclusions:

  • The combination of serum total IgE, blood eosinophilia, and FeNO offers improved diagnosis, phenotyping, and follow-up for children with asthma.
  • This multi-marker approach is essential for optimizing the care of pediatric asthma patients.
  • Utilizing these markers aids in understanding the transition from childhood to adult asthma.
